BORT

Once the scope and ambitions of the future Westermoskee have become clear, residents mobilise and establish their action group, BORT. Counting on the participation of about seventy local inhabitants, BORT is contesting the size and height of the future mosque. Rather than opposing the construction of the mosque in its entirety, BORT tries to prevent it from becoming too large and present. Many conversations and discussions with the project partners of the Westermoskee follow, but at the end of 2005, most objections are met, with one exception: the height of the minaret. BORT wants it to be lower, while the people behind the project want it to remain as planned. When BORT ultimately loses this struggle, they stay on as a monitoring instrument, until they disband in 2012
